History
Fumakilla's origins date to 1920 in Japan, placing the brand within the early development of modern household insect control in the country. The company emerged in a period when Japanese households were adopting manufactured solutions against mosquitoes and other pests. Early insect-control products were associated with smoke, burning materials and coil-based methods. These formats became important because they could provide protection over an extended period without requiring complex equipment. Over subsequent decades, household pest control developed alongside advances in chemistry, packaging and small electrical appliances. Fumakilla's portfolio expanded beyond traditional mosquito-control formats into aerosol insecticides, electrically heated products, repellents and treatments for different household pests. This evolution allowed the brand to address both prevention and direct pest treatment, as well as indoor and outdoor use. The company consequently became associated not only with mosquito coils but with a broader household insect-control range. The Japanese market has remained central to the brand's identity. It is a technically and commercially demanding environment in which products must meet detailed regulatory requirements and consumer expectations concerning efficacy, odour, duration, convenience and safe handling. Seasonal purchasing patterns are especially important, although some pest-control products are used throughout the year. Product categories also vary by living arrangement, including apartments, detached homes, gardens and recreational spaces. Fumakilla has also operated beyond Japan, with Asian markets offering significant relevance because warm climates can create prolonged or year-round demand for mosquito and insect-control products. International product portfolios and distribution arrangements may differ by country because pesticide registrations, formulations, labeling rules and local pest conditions are not uniform. Products and positioning
A Japanese household pest-control brand combining familiar mosquito-control products with broader insecticide, repellent and home-protection solutions.
Mosquito coilsMosquito control
Coil-based products designed to release insect-control ingredients gradually while burning. Mosquito coils are among the formats most closely associated with Fumakilla's historical identity and are used in homes, gardens and other outdoor or semi-outdoor settings, subject to local instructions and safety precautions.
Aerosol insecticidesHousehold insecticide
Spray products intended for direct treatment of flying or crawling household insects. Depending on the product and market, formulations may target mosquitoes, flies, cockroaches or other pests. Packaging, permitted claims and application instructions vary according to local registration and safety rules.
Electric mosquito vaporisersMosquito control
Electrically heated or powered devices that disperse an insect-control formulation over time. These products offer an alternative to burning coils and are suited to indoor use where consumers want a continuous, low-effort mosquito-control solution.
Personal insect repellentsPersonal protection
Repellent products intended to reduce insect landings on exposed skin or clothing. Product forms may include sprays or other topical or wearable formats, but the precise assortment depends on market approvals and local product catalogs.
Household pest-control productsHome pest management
A broader group of products for managing household pests, including treatments aimed at crawling insects and other nuisance species. The range complements mosquito-focused products by addressing different rooms, use occasions and pest problems.
